Did you configure your Neo4j server to listen on the external interface? It's explained in the docs here: https://neo4j.com/docs/operations-manual/current/configuration/connectors/
On Tue, Feb 12, 2019 at 8:58 AM <andrea.balz...@keypartner.it> wrote: > Hi everyone, i'm fairly new to neo4j and i've been experimenting a bit > using Neo4j Java Driver to populate a neo4j database on a standalone > server. It's been working fine as long as the application and the server > were running on the same machine (i was using bolt://localhost:port as > uri), but now that i moved the server on a different machine it's giving me > a "ServiceUnavailableException: Failed to establish connection with the > server" > > driver = GraphDatabase.driver("bolt://" + neo4jSettings.NEO4J_HOSTNAME + > ":" + neo4jSettings.NEO4J_PORT, AuthTokens.basic(neo4jSettings. > NEO4J_USERNAME, neo4jSettings.NEO4J_PASSWORD)) > > I'm not sure what is going wrong, but i can reach the machine just fine so > the problem has to be somewhere else and my best guess is that i have to > change something inside the .conf file, can anyone point me in the right > direction please?
